Sameer Man Singh

Sameer joined OXFAM in January 2020. He has over a decade-long experience in delivering environment and development communications solutions for multilateral organizations including the UN World Food Programme, International Union for Conservation of Nature (IUCN Asia), World Wide Fund for Nature (WWF), Winrock International and SNV. A keen advocate for the environment, he also worked as a radio journalist in Nepal. He holds a Master’s degree in Environmental Science from Tribhuvan University and a certificate in Effective Inter-Cultural Communication from the National University of Singapore.
Telling stories: For Sameer, Joining the TROSA programme has been a sort of 'homecoming'. As a university student, he aspired to orient his career towards becoming a water resource management professional and based his thesis on pollution in Nepal's transboundary rivers.
"It feels great to be part of OXFAM and the amazing TROSA team, and to be able to tell stories of the inextricable relationship between people and rivers, and its ebbs and flows."
Sameer is based in Kathmandu, Nepal.
